J. M. Bourne is a scholar working on Plant Science, Insect Science and Cell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, J. M. Bourne has authored 10 papers receiving a total of 378 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Plant Science, 3 papers in Insect Science and 2 papers in Cell Biology. Recurrent topics in J. M. Bourne’s work include Nematode management and characterization studies (8 papers), Entomopathogenic Microorganisms in Pest Control (3 papers) and Plant Pathogens and Fungal Diseases (2 papers). J. M. Bourne is often cited by papers focused on Nematode management and characterization studies (8 papers), Entomopathogenic Microorganisms in Pest Control (3 papers) and Plant Pathogens and Fungal Diseases (2 papers). J. M. Bourne coll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Cuba and United States. J. M. Bourne's co-authors include B. R. Kerry, F.A.A.M. De Leij, B. R. Kerry, S. R. Gowen, M. S. Rao, P. Parvatha Reddy, Laura Herrera‐Hidalgo, Tim H. Mauchline and D. Sosnowska and has published in prestigious journals such as Soil Biology and Biochemistry, Biocontrol Science and Technology and Emu - Austral Ornithology.
